At 5:29 PM -0800 3/12/00, Kim Springer wrote: >Here's what I want: > >Single Cab, 2.1L ('86 - '91), 4 Speed, and White. You may want to seriously look in to what is involved in importing a used single cab from Canada. We have tons of them here. Mind you, we have a lot more double cabs than single cabs, but it just adds to the thrill of the chase. You would not have a problem finding one meeting your specifications, as long as you didn't need it, like, right away. Like any good bus search, it'd prolly take you several months to find one. I don't know what's involved in importation in that direction, but I've brought both my last buses into Canada from california and it's really no big deal as long as you getthe paperwork laid out properly ahead of time. White, BTW, is far and away the most common colour for these things. In fact, there is a double cab for sale right here on Bowen Island right now. There are four vanagon pickups on the Island (all double cabs, sorry), and only about 2,500 people live here! And, yes, I've even seen syncro pickups, although I don't know if they are aftermarket conversions or what. I remember one of them was white, FWIW.
